Northbridge History Project Update

The Northbridge History Studies Day 2008 was a smashing success with over 153 in attendance. John Hyde, MLA, opened the day, at which such luminaries as Dr Bobbie Oliver and Marcus Canning presented papers alongside internationally renowned documentary photographer Darren Clark, who presented images of a modern day Northbridge. Keep an eye out for the Northbridge History Project at the upcoming Pride Fairday where they will be conducting vox pops from community members. Research material on Northbridge is available online at www.northbridgehistory.wa.gov.au and community members are encouraged to get involved by providing photographs, documents and other memorabilia that will not only help future generations, but insure your place in history.
